Output e20f936b969082d87b7cb8bb3add3b7514d9c69b3339a7e4581eeff7b356ea72:3

value
3915500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84bf693ef7bd3c9c0068c37dcc1e7591090909f9 OP_EQUALVERIFY OP_CHECKSIG
address
1D6uVoMTT8DVU6Q3VfZdNPKPQsDEUaJFqw
transaction
e20f936b969082d87b7cb8bb3add3b7514d9c69b3339a7e4581eeff7b356ea72
confirmations
532889
spent
true